Output f3e64504ccfcdc2b5a87ced151cc1053abcdd016aa61cc09f672a6bb8da314a2:0

value
149570
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f1aba875da4480103a0f61adcc387953bff68e1e OP_EQUAL
address
3PirQnVadZaW6tN1m8hdJXKZcfQMpZ2mM3
transaction
f3e64504ccfcdc2b5a87ced151cc1053abcdd016aa61cc09f672a6bb8da314a2
confirmations
280740
spent
true